What This Data Tells You About West Side Volunteer Fire Department

West Side Volunteer Fire Department operates as a Volunteer department in Readyville, within Cannon County, and the HIFLD and USFA records give a precise structural picture of its response capacity. The department reports 16 total personnel, 1 station, no truck inventory reported. EMS capability is listed as not provided.

Benchmarking against the state gives this profile context. Tennessee has 921 registered fire departments and 22,125 total personnel, averaging roughly 24 staff per department. West Side Volunteer Fire Department runs 33% below that state average, signalling a leaner crew typical of smaller jurisdictions or heavily volunteer-staffed areas. The state records about 47,400 fires, 115 fire deaths, and 52% volunteer coverage each year, which shapes training, funding priorities, and mutual-aid patterns felt at every department in the state.

No FEMA AFG or SAFER grant awards are recorded against this department's FDID in USAspending data, which is common for smaller or volunteer-heavy organizations that lean on state and local funding instead.
